Alan Keyes gets booed at Labor Day parade
My mom lives in Naperville (a heavily conservative area) and Alan Keyes was in the parade. The entire crowd erupted into boos and refused to take the pamphlets they were trying to hand out.

There was a Bush/Cheney float, too - half the crowd booed it and half cheered it. That's actually a hopeful sign, since Naperville tends to go almost entirely Repub.
